Transaction 20ede194edc816853c35253ffb44912116bf1ee71f2ee0bf639ec65c02ad585d

69 Input
2 Outputs
  • 20ede194edc816853c35253ffb44912116bf1ee71f2ee0bf639ec65c02ad585d:0
  • value  30648138
    address  bc1q3vlyhfa8xzk069685alvnyj6v29pfknurdlwfxpj94are2sz8qss9hmxpk
  • 20ede194edc816853c35253ffb44912116bf1ee71f2ee0bf639ec65c02ad585d:1
  • value  163100000
    address  1NasLM7SRVdx9bQsiEpaHwNGr9grAL94Rj